5. Coastal Flooding Danger
Coastal flooding poses a major threat to Atlantic Metropolis, New Jersey, significantly throughout November. A number of converging elements exacerbate this vulnerability throughout this late autumn month. The astronomical excessive tides related to the brand new and full moon cycles mix with the elevated probability of nor’easters. These highly effective storms, characterised by sturdy northeast winds and low atmospheric stress, drive ocean water in direction of the shore, resulting in storm surges that may inundate low-lying coastal areas. Moreover, the upper common sea ranges noticed in latest a long time, attributed to local weather change, amplify the affect of those storm surges, rising the attain and severity of coastal flooding.
Historic data doc the affect of coastal flooding in Atlantic Metropolis. The notorious Ash Wednesday Storm of 1962 prompted widespread devastation alongside the New Jersey coast, together with Atlantic Metropolis, highlighting town’s vulnerability to excessive climate occasions. More moderen storms, reminiscent of Hurricane Sandy in 2012, additional underscored the potential for vital injury and disruption from coastal flooding, emphasizing the necessity for sturdy coastal defenses and efficient emergency preparedness plans.
